LAYS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review
3 of the 8,238 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in STKd 100% NVDA & 100% AMD ETF (LAYS)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$493K — down 79% from $2.34M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in LAYS was balanced in Q4 2025: 2 funds opened new positions, 2 closed out, 0 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.
The largest buyer was UBS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$17.6K. The largest seller was Old Mission Capital, cutting an estimated $1.11M.
